Mihaylo, the former chairman and chief executive officer of Inter-Tel, Incorporated, founded Inter-Tel in Phoenix in 1969, beginning the 38-year journey that is Inter-Tel- evolving from simply providing business telephone systems to offering complete managed services and software that help businesses facilitate communication, increase customer service and productivity.

Mr. Mihaylo's philosophy has always been to focus on the needs of the customer, growing Inter-Tel from a one-man business to a global organization employing over 2,000 people, and servicing more than 500,000 business customers through a network of more than 60 direct sales offices and over 500 resellers worldwide. In 1981, common shares of Inter-Tel stock were offered to the public and are quoted on the NASDAQ national market system under the symbol INTL.

In 2009, Mr. Mihaylo began a new role as CEO and majority shareholder of Crexendo, Inc., a leading provider of e-commerce software for small businesses and entrepreneurs.

Mr. Mihaylo was born in Los Angeles, California. After three years of service in the United States Army's 101st Airborne Division, Steve moved to Tempe, Arizona in 1964 and began working for Western Electric as a field services engineer. Returning to California in 1966, Mr. Mihaylo attended Orange Coast College and California State University,
Fullerton, completing a Bachelor of Arts degree in Accounting and Finance in just 30 months. In 2007, Cal State Fullerton recognized Steve for his outstanding career achievements by presenting him with the Distinguished Alumni Award.

In addition to his professional career, Mr. Mihaylo has served on the boards of numerous community organizations and was Juvenile Diabetes Research Foundation 2004 Man of The Year. He has been a strong proponent of higher education in both Arizona and California.

Steve's support of his alma mater through his leadership and philanthropy reflects his generosity as well as his commitment to Cal State Fullerton. In addition to serving on the College of Business and Economics Dean's Advisory Board, he also served as Chairman of the College's first-ever comprehensive fundraising campaign. As Chair, Steve led a 12-member Campaign Cabinet for their $20 million campaign to construct a new state-of-the art building and to fund innovative student and faculty programs as well as scholarship support for talented and deserving students. In addition to his $4.5 million leadership gift to the Campaign, Mr. Mihaylo made an additional record-setting $30 million gift to this alma mater. The new Steven G. Mihaylo Hall and the Steven G. Mihaylo College of Business and Economics are a tribute to his generosity.
